Nettet26. jan. 2016 · From LINQPad, click Add Connection and choose Entity Framework in the bottom listbox. LINQPad supports both DbContext and ObjectContext models. Click Next. Click Browse and locate the assembly (DLL) that you built in step 1: Choose your typed DbContext class and Entity Data Model: Confirm the database details and click OK.

Nettet11. apr. 2024 · The following examples show the steps to generating a .gitignore file in VSCode with the help of the CodeZombie extension. Step 1: Install the gitignore extension for VSCode. Step 2: Open the command palette using Ctrl+Shift+P and type Add gitignore. Step 3: Select the framework or the language of your project, and the extension will … michael grossbard md ny
